About our Organisation

The Soil Association, formed in 1946, is the only UK charity which works across the spectrum of human health, the environment and animal welfare. That’s because we cannot tackle these issues in isolation.

We campaign for change, we support farming innovation, we serve healthy food in communities, we support and grow the organic market, and we protect forests. We couldn't do any of this without our supporters, partners, donors and dedicated staff. We make a difference in the world where it’s needed the most.

About the Opportunity

This is a new role in the Group Finance team, which supports the Soil Association Charity and its subsidiaries, a mix of charitable and commercial entities. You would provide dedicated finance support to the Soil Association Land Trust charity as well as business partnering with budget holders in the main Charity and central Group teams. This breadth of remit means the work will be varied and will provide exposure to both charity and commercial accounting as well as the opportunity to work closely with decision makers in the Group.
